5 Reasons Why Beginner Muay Thai Classes Are the Perfect Workout for Everyone

  • Written by Modern Australian

Muay Thai is a distinct fighting style that employs punches, kicks, elbows, and knee strikes. It is a discipline that requires concentration, discipline, and physical fitness. If you want to learn Muay Thai, you need to begin with the basics. Muay Thai introductory courses are meant for people who have little to no experience with the sport. These classes are designed to teach pupils Muay Thai concepts while increasing their fitness, coordination, and overall health.

At the start of beginner Muay Thai classes, students will be introduced to the basic techniques, footwork, and stances. The trainers will also teach you how to wrap your hands and wear gloves properly. As you progress through the classes, you'll be taught more advanced techniques and combinations. The classes are usually fast-paced and energetic, making them ideal for anyone who wants to improve their cardiovascular fitness.

Muay Thai Is a Total Body Workout

Muay Thai is a total body workout that engages every major muscle group, making it the perfect workout for everyone. For a beginner, Muay Thai classes provide a comprehensive training program that improves not only physical fitness but also mental and emotional well-being. This martial art involves a combination of kicks, punches, and knee strikes that require coordination, balance, and strength. The high-intensity training, coupled with the discipline and focus required to execute the techniques effectively, leads to improved cardiovascular health, endurance, and flexibility.

Muay Thai Is Suitable for All Fitness Levels

One of the best things about beginner Muay Thai lessons is that they are appropriate for people of various fitness levels. Muay Thai does not require any prior martial arts or fitness expertise to begin. The lessons are designed to be progressive, with instructors modifying exercises and techniques to accommodate each individual's fitness level. This makes Muay Thai accessible to people of all ages and fitness levels.

Muay Thai Provides Mental Benefits

Muay Thai is more than just a physical workout; it also has mental benefits. Muay Thai involves focus and concentration, which might aid in the reduction of tension and anxiety. Physical and mental exercise together can assist in improving your mental health, raise your confidence, and increase your general sense of well-being.

Muay Thai Is a Fun and Social Activity

Muay Thai is a social and enjoyable sport that can help you meet new people and create new friends. Introductory lessons are an excellent way to get started in the sport, and you'll almost certainly meet other newcomers who are also learning the ropes. As you develop, you will be able to spar with other students and join the larger Muay Thai community. This might be an excellent approach to keep yourself motivated and involved in your training program.

Muay Thai Teaches Self-Defense Skills

The striking techniques used in Muay Thai can be used for self-defence in real-life situations. Learning these techniques can help you to feel more confident and empowered in your daily life. The self-defence aspect of Muay Thai is especially important for women, who are often targets of violence and harassment.
